### TL;DR
|
||||
VoiceCraft is a token infilling neural codec language model, that achieves state-of-the-art performance on both **speech editing** and **zero-shot text-to-speech (TTS)** on in-the-wild data including audiobooks, internet videos, and podcasts.
|
||||
@@ -8,20 +7,22 @@ VoiceCraft is a token infilling neural codec language model, that achieves state
|
||||
To clone or edit an unseen voice, VoiceCraft needs only a few seconds of reference.

### Run locally
|
||||
After environment setup install additional dependencies:
|
||||
```bash
|
||||
apt-get install -y espeak espeak-data libespeak1 libespeak-dev
|
||||
apt-get install -y festival*
|
||||
apt-get install -y build-essential
|
||||
apt-get install -y flac libasound2-dev libsndfile1-dev vorbis-tools
|
||||
apt-get install -y libxml2-dev libxslt-dev zlib1g-dev
|
||||
pip install -r gradio_requirements.txt
|
||||
```
|
||||
|
||||
Run gradio server from terminal or [`gradio_app.ipynb`](./gradio_app.ipynb):
|
||||
```bash
|
||||
python gradio_app.py
|
||||
```
|
||||
It is ready to use on [default url](http://127.0.0.1:7860).
